Savage Gardeners Sarracenia chelsonii is a cross between Sarracenia Purpurea and Sarracenia Rubra. The deep red coloration of rubra is combined with a wide pitcher opening of purpurea to form a whimsically shaped lid. Your new plant is a small plants that fit well in a 2.5" pot. Growing Requirements Light full sun Soil pure peat, peat-sand mix, peat-perlite mix, or long-fiber sphagnum Fertilizing do not apply fertilizer - if grown indoors, feed with bugs, dried bloodworms, or fish food Humidity 50-90% Water keep wet at all times, provide water that is low in salts and minerals such as rain or distilled water Temperature 45-90°F Dormancy period winter
